Several injured after landing craft capsises

Coast Guard deployed following landing craft capsising --
A Maldives Ports Limited (MPL) landing craft capsised near the MPL port area early this morning, with fourteen people on board, including several foreign nationals.
Six individuals were injured in the incident - two Bangladeshis and four Maldivians - and were taken to Indhira Gandhi Memorial Hospital for treatment. A 32-year-old Bangladeshi sustained the most serious injuries, while a 25-year-old Maldivian also suffered significant injuries.
According to MPL, the landing craft was carrying materials for port maintenance and repair work when it overturned at around 3:44 a.m. Authorities are currently investigating the cause of the accident.
This marks the second such incident in the region this year. On 15 October, another landing craft capsised, claiming the lives of three people - one Maldivian, one Indian, and one Sri Lankan.
